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Learners Guide to Metal Polishing - Normally, metal polishing is needed for an attractive appearance or clean-room situations. It's one of the most favored techniques for its success in intensifying the overall beauty of the product, as an example, vehicle parts, kitchenware or motorbike parts. Besides that, a good number of clean-rooms would need a burnished finish so as to minimize the permeability of the material that can result in debris to gather and contaminate. A superb demonstration of this application could be in vacuum chambers. There are lots of approaches to finish metals, and we can look into a number of the processes involved. Metals may be finished electromechanically, chemically, manually by hand, or with purpose built buffing machines. A buffing paste or compound is routinely utilised, which can include dolomite, limestone, tripoli, aluminum oxide, chromium oxide, chalk, or iron oxide. Polishing stainless steel, due to its low th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its somewhat high viscosity is considered the most time intensive. Opposite of that scenario, items made of non-ferrous metal are usually more receptive to finishing, since these require the lower amount of operations.
Where a greater processing quality is simply not crucial, increased pad speeds should be employed. A slower pad speed is used in the event that a superior mirror finish is important. Polishing buffs covered in compound are markedly impacted by specific force on the pad. The level of the pressure on the surface can be heightened to a specific level, but further exceeding the ideal amount of force not only decreases the quality of treatment, but also worsens performance, can bring about wear to the part, plus there is also an evident heating up of the work-pieces, due to friction. When polishing thinner material, it's increased heat (and the relating flexibility of the material) that cause components to bend, warp or flex. Basically, it will require a highly skilled polisher to factor in each one of these points to equally avert damage to the part and to perform the work efficiently. In order to radically improve the quality of the resulting finish, the buffing operation really needs to be completed with significantly less aggression and not so much pressure so as to in due course deliver a surface area that is free of scratches or fine lines left behind by the finishing process, subsequently arriving at a lovely mirror finish.
